Jaeger-LeCoultre has applied the Hybris Mechanica name to a number of different watches, starting with a trio of highly complicated watches sold as a set, for $2.5 million, in 2009. For several years, JLC followed a number-series naming convention (the 2014 Master Ultra-Thin Minute Repeater Flying Tourbillon, for instance, was launched as Hybris Mechanica 11). Today, however, the company uses the caliber number rather than a series number, and the most recent addition to the Hybris Mechanica collection, launching at Watches & Wonders 2021, is the Hybris Mechanica Calibre 185 Quadriptyque. It s not only the most complicated Reverso ever made, it s one of the most complicated watches Jaeger-LeCoultre has ever made, period – by the company s count, a total of 11 complications.
